Step-by-step explanation:
So first you need to know the formula for the area of a segment of a circle which is... A = 0.5 × (θ - sinθ) × r²
*make sure that you do this question in RADIANS
You know that θ (the angle) is 90° which is equal to π/2 and the radius is 3, so from here you just plug in numbers to the equation.
A = 0.5 × ( π/2 - sin(π/2)) × 3²
